Cedar Creek Campground Umpqua Nat Forest/Cottage Grove Dist

This campground, 40 minutes from Cottage Grove, is situated in a stand of old growth Douglas fir along Brice Creek. Eight campsites, including one large multi-family unit for troop camping, are available, complete with concrete fire-pits, wooden tables and tenting areas. Activities include swimming, fishing, hiking and gold panning. Crawfish Trail is located one mile east on road #2470 for those interested in hiking. Water is available from Brice Creek.

Access:From Cottage Grove Ranger Station, take Row River Road #2400 east 17 miles to Brice Creek Road #2470 and stay to the right. Continue for 4 miles along Brice Creek to the campground, on the north side of road #2470.
Usage:Moderate
Elevation:1600'
Season:May 25 - Nov 30
